I would like to install the WooCommerce plug in but it says I need to update my PHP for my website. Any ideas how to do that?

Thanks

Hi Alan.
You may try to do the following.
1. Go to your account click the “API Downloads” tab and download the plugin. (However, when you have the basic/free version already installed do deactivate and delete the basic version before installing Premium Version to avoid any conflict.)
2. Then install the downloaded plugin into your WordPress / WooCommerce Site.
3. You will get an Activation Key and Activation Email at My Account (API Keys).
4. Go to your site admin and the Settings page of the plugin and activate it using email and key. All the best.

you need to get in touch with site support to move your site over to the new servers with the updated php.
click on hte help center and sitesupport and open a ticket
tell them you need the updated php to install woocommerce
they should respond with an offer to upgrade to the new beta servers - accept this and you should be sorted in a couple of hours.
then you will be able to install woocommerce - and have a faster site...

Funny should bring that up, this is exactly what flew by my brain this afternoon. I have no experience, but would love the know the answers to your questions about pricing, etc.

Whenever you charge anything for a service always keep in mind what it would cost the client to do on their own or to have others do for them. That essentially forms the basis of your sales pitch.

Sure there are people in third world countries that can do stuff like this for them at a fraction of the cost that you may be charging, but then they (your potential clients) become project managers and that kind of defeats the purpose (another selling point for you).

Also, as far as SEO methods, are these third world vendors buying up bogus traffic with automated hits along with other black hat strategies? Again, it's all about positioning the client for the likelihood of failure if they decide not to use your services.

Also remember that you really control the situation. If a client is nickeling and diming you, think twice about whether you want to work with them. Those types of clients are usually your biggest headaches.

It helps if you have a portfolio to back up your price quotes and why you stand strong on those quotes. It helps even more if you can show from an SEO perspective that you took website(s) that had little traffic and using the techniques that you will employ for them, how you are now getting loads of traffic because of it. But if you don't have that reputation to start you can offer them a deal where they will be the clients that give you glowing reviews after you deliver for them. Do this for a couple of clients and you're good to go.

Personally, I think all SEO services should be charged on a monthly basis. Even with the website itself, you could offer them a certain number of SEO posts per month or something like that. All items such as graphics, audio, video, should be extra.
